“…Among the diarylethenes hitherto reported, most of the heteroaryl diarylethenes bear thiophene or benzothiophene rings, which exhibit excellent thermal stability and outstanding fatigue resistance [6][7][8][9][10], with only a few reports concerning other heteroaryl moieties, such as thiazole, [11][12][13] indole, [14] benzofuran, [15] indene, [16] pyrazole, [17] pyrrole, [18] among others. There are a few examples of photochromic diarylethenes bearing oxazole rings [19][20][21][22]. However, diarylethene derivatives with an isoxazole unit hitherto reported are very rare [23].…”
